Game Recap: Women's Lacrosse |

Tigers Down Golden Falcons, 20-6, in CACC Clash



Lyndhurst, N.J. - Senior Rose Bachmayer (Philadelphia, Pa./Archbishop Ryan) totaled a career-high 10 points, while juniors Devon Felix (Huntingdon Valley, Pa./Lower Moreland) and Dana Trevito (Voorhees, N.J./Eastern Regional) each scored four goals apiece as the Holy Family University women's lacrosse team defeated Felician University 20-6 in a Central Atlantic Collegiate Conference (CACC) contest on Thursday night at Lyndhurst Recreation.
 
Score: Holy Family 20, Felician 6
Records: Holy Family (2-9, 2-4 CACC) | Felician (0-10, 0-6 CACC)
Location: Lyndhurst, N.J. (Lyndhurst Recreation)
 
How It Happened
 
* Holy Family scored the game's first four goals as four different players found the back of the net, including senior Taylor Walker (Williamstown, N.J./Williamstown) who capped the early run with her first collegiate goal.  The Tigers led 4-0 within the first five minutes of action before Felician cut the lead to 5-2 by the 17:41 mark.
 
* The Tigers went on to outscore the Golden Falcons, 5-3, the rest of the first half and held a 10-5 lead at halftime after capping the scoring of the first stanza with a goal by Felix at the 2:32 mark. The goal by Felix jumpstarted a stretch of seven unanswered goals by the Tigers to open the second half as Holy Family took a commanding 17-5 lead by the midway point. Trevito tallied the final four goals of the run.
 
* The Golden Falcons scored one goal in the second half coming at the 13:47 mark halting the Tigers 8-0 run that started at the end of the first half.  Holy Family followed with the game's final three goals over the next 12-plus minutes.
 
Game Notes
 
* Bachmayer finished the game with a career-high 10 points while scoring a career-best seven goals.  Her 10 points ties her for second most in a single game in program history. Trevito was the last Tigers' player to record double-digit points in a game doing so last season ironically enough versus Felician. 
 
* Felix and Trevito each came away with four goals apiece in the win. Trevito finished with five points.
 
* Walker was among three players to record their first collegiate goals in the game.  She finished with two goals to go along with five ground balls and two caused turnovers.  Sophomore Casey Schweitzer (Lagrangeville, N.Y./Arlington) and freshman Halley Armbruster (Philadelphia, Pa./St. Huberts) each tallied a goal for their first collegiate scores.
 
* Goalkeeper Amber Frechette (Philadelphia, Pa./Archbishop Ryan) made five saves in net after facing just 11 shots by the Golden Falcons.  She now has 296 career saves; four shy of 300.
 
* Holy Family tied its season-high with 20 goals scored.  It marked the second time this season the Tigers reached that many goals in a game with the previous coming in the win at Nyack College back in March. 
 
* Holy Family set a new season-high with 46 shots, including a season-best 37 on-goal. Defensively, the Tigers held the Golden Falcons to just six goals and 12 shots; both season-lows for an opponent this season. 
 
* Malikah Croom and Christianna Louzan each scored two goals apiece for the Golden Falcons.
 
All-Time Series
Tonight marked just the third meeting between Holy Family and Felician in the series' short history which first began in 2016.  The Tigers remain undefeated versus the Golden Falcons in the series at 3-0.
